Main issues, as the Inspector framed them

  • Whether the proposal would be inappropriate development in the Green Belt having regard to the National Planning Policy Framework and any relevant development plan policies, including its effect on openness
  • If the development is inappropriate, whether the harm by reason of inappropriateness, and any other harm, would be clearly outweighed by other considerations, so as to amount to the very special circumstances required to justify the proposal

What decided it

The detached garage qualifies as an extension under NPPF paragraph 154(c) rather than inappropriate development, as it represents a modest, non-disproportionate addition with a close relationship to the existing dwelling.

Framework references: 154

Plan policies cited: Policy DM4
